KATHMANDU, March 3: Machhindra Football Club have clinched the title of the third KP Oli Cup Men's Football Championship.


Machhindra defeated Tribhuvan Army Club 2-0 in the final match held at the Dasharath Stadium in Tripureshwar on Monday to lift the title for the third time in a row.


Machhindra took the lead in the first half of the match. In the 29th minute of the match, Army's Bimal Pandey scored an own goal from Andres Nia's pass, giving Machhindra a 1-0 lead. Machhindra doubled its lead in the second half with Stefano Zalli scoring in the 72nd minute to ensure the team's victory.

Prime Minister KP Sharma Oli had reached the stadium with his wife Radhika Shakya to watch the final match. Former captain and goalkeeper of the Italian football team Gianluigi Buffon was also present as a special guest during the match.


The stadium was packed with spectators and artists gave musical performances before the match.


The KP Oli Cup, organized by the National Youth Association Nepal, began on February 23. Machhindra had previously won the title in the first edition by defeating Satdobato Youth Club 5-3 in a tiebreaker.


Machhindra also won the second edition defeating New Road Team (NRT) 5-4 in a tiebreaker.


With this victory, Machhindra Football Club has made a hat-trick in the KP Oli Cup.
